    Quote Originally Posted by RAM Engineer View Post
    How's accuracy been for you? Internet reports of big MOA values have scared me off, although other than that it looks very appealing.
    It’s a 2 MOA rifle without much effort using green tip. I haven’t tried squeezing out more; I did remove the silicone (?) barrel blocks and replaced the HG with a true freefloat. It’s no coyote rifle, for sure.
